Grape Jelly

Origin: Madrid, Spain

Source: Anonymous, 1921

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Separate the grape grains from the stems.
  2. Cook them in water until soft.
  3. Strain through a sieve to extract the juice.
  4. Measure the juice and place it in a pot with the fire.
  5. For every approximately 500 grams of juice, add 100 grams of sugar.
  6. Skim off the foam carefully as it rises.
  7. Remove from the heat when the mixture is well cooked and has reached a proper consistency (when it jellies upon cooling).
